Current credit crunch is largely perceived as the main reason behind the collapse of the property market in international system. The reason as to why credit crunch resulted into the collapse of the property market can be traced back to the subprime mortgage crises which emerged due to the imprudent lending practices of the bank. By definition, a subprime borrower is a borrower whose credit has not been entirely satisfactory due to historical defaults on payments against loans taken. (Budworth,2009). However, such borrowers offer more lucrative options for the banks and financial institutions to lend because of their higher risk. High risk borrowers are often charged high rates therefore there is always a chance to earn high on such relationships. Based on this simple principle of risk and return banks and financial institutions started to lend to their subprime borrowers especially in mortgage markets. However, banks and other financial institutions, at the same time, also started the process of securitization through which the mortgage portfolio held as security with the bank were bundled and securities were sold out against such collaterals in the open market. The basic purpose was to recoup the liquidity lost in making the loans to subprime borrowers. Crises in property markets started to emerge when subprime borrowers started to default on their commitments and as such banks have to pay out to the holders of mortgage backed securities through other means as with the default of the borrowers a mismatch in cash flows were created. Clinical Evidence Base In the management of patient with vestibular neuronitis (VN), is the usage of pharmacological treatment (glucocorticoid) more effective in terms of recovery compared to supportive treatment alone. Vestibular neuronitis is defined as the dysfunction of the peripheral vestibular system with associated vertigo, nausea and vomiting.5 Hearing symptoms such as deafness and tinnitus are rarely associated with vestibular neuronitis.3 Up to today, the cause of vestibular neuronitis remains unknown hence, the main treatment options remain unclear limiting it to corticosteroids, antiviral therapy and vestibular exercises.1,4 The OneSearch UWA library database was searched and keywords used were ââ¬Å"acuteâ⬠, ââ¬Å"vestibular neuronitisâ⬠, ââ¬Å"corticosteroidâ⬠, ââ¬Å"conservative treatmentâ⬠and ââ¬Å"head manoeuvreâ⬠. Other related terms were also included in the search. One study was identified, ââ¬Å"Corticosteroid and vestibular exercises in vestibular neuronitisâ⬠by John K. Goudakos, MSc; Konstantinos D. Markou, George Psillas, Victor Vital, Miltiadis Tsaligopoulos.1 The study is single-blind randomised clinical trial measuring the recovery of 40 patients with vestibular neuronitis by using vestibular exercises vs corticosteroid at 1, 6 and 12 months.1 The 40 patients were randomised into 2 groups where one received corticosteroid therapy and the other underwent vestibular exercises for 3 weeks.1 Recovery was measured by monitoring the scores on the European Evaluation of Vertigo scale (EEV), Dizziness Handicap Inventory (DHI) and vestibular evoked myogenic potentials (VEMPs).1 Patient included in the study were: Aged 18-80 presenting with history of acute onset associated with vertigo, nausea, vomiting, postural imbalance, no hearing loss, no central lesion on neurological examination, horizontal nystagmus with rotational component, ipsilateral deficit on the head thrust test and unilateral reduced calorie response on the electronystagmography(ENG).1 Patient excluded from the study were: glaucoma, recent infection, signs of central vestibular dysfunction, history of chronic vestibular dysfunction, hearing loss and patients that are contraindicated for steroid use.1 Results: At 1 month, the EEV in both group showed an improvement with a score of 3.75 in the vestibular exercise group and 4.17 in the corticosteroid group. However (P>0.05) hence there is not significant difference between the two groups.1 At the 6 months follow up, 35% of the patient in the corticosteroid group had a complete disease resolution compared to 5% in the vestibular exercise group, (P1 At the 12 months follow up for disease resolution, 50% of patient in the corticosteroid group showed complete disease resolution and 45% of the patient in the vestibular exercise group showed disease resolution however (P>0.05) hence there was no significant difference.1 Strength and Weaknesses This study is level II based on the NHMRC. Methods of measuring outcome were clearly explained. Inclusion and exclusion criteria were well defined. Single-blinded study. No statistically significant difference in age, sex and disease onset between both groups. Small sample size of 40 patients. Method of randomisation was not defined, may include bias. Measurement of recovery did not include other factors. Tools of measurement such as VEMPs are good for diagnostic clarification but not measurement of disease. Measurement did not include clinical improvement. Application ââ¬â This study showed that there is a quicker resolution of vestibular neuronitis in the short term within 6 months of corticosteroid therapy. However in the long term follow up, (12 months) the efficacy of corticosteroid therapy is similar to vestibular exercises. Further studies should be performed combining vestibular exercises with corticosteroid therapy with a larger sample size to measure efficacy. In this case, my GP did not offer corticosteroid therapy to the patient but educated the patient on vestibular exercises which corresponds to the finding above because corticosteroid therapy does not offer additional long term benefits. Solubility tests To evaluate which oils and surfactants present better results at forming microemulsions, we pre-selected four different oils and two different surfactants to perform solubility tests with our model API. The oils tested were Ethyl Oleate, FK-Sunflower Oil, FK-MCT Oil, and Miglyol 840. Moreover, the surfactants used were Tween 80 viscous liquid and Labrasol. As shown in Fig. 1 solubility tests were performed using the following method: Firstly, an excessive amount of our API was added with a metal spatula to a concentrate (oil, surfactant or mixture). The chemicals were precisely weighed, and the resulting suspension was mixed, at room temperature, for 16h at 480rpm, at 21à ºC, on the magnetic stirrer. Secondly, the resulting mixed suspension was transferred to disposable plastic eppis and centrifuged at 10000 g for 10min. Thirdly, a new dilution was prepared using the supernatant that resulted from centrifugation. This new dilution must be much less concentrated in order to be measured by UV-Spectrometry. Lastly, the dilution was taken for analytics in a UV-spectrophotometer, where the absorbance values were measured at 425nm, using disposable plastic cuvettes. Other materials used during the procedure were disposable plastic pipettes, small glass beakers and small glass bottles with lids. The method was repeated three times for each oil, surfactant and mixture stock solution. The dilutions were also repeated three times for higher accuracy in the results. Fig. 1. Scheme showing the solubility test procedure. In order to analyze the data, the maximum values of diluted API in the concentrate were calculated from a calibration line for each of the mixtures (API + concentrate) being tested. Emulsifying capacity evaluation by PDMPD method In the second phase of our formulations study, we wanted to evaluate emulsifying capacity. We used the Phase Diagram by Micro Plate Dilution (PDMPD) method that consists in gradually diluting the oil phase with the water phase in a microtitre plate. The PDMPD method is an efficient and innovative approach that allows time and material savings while creating pseudo ternary phase diagrams for microemulsions and nanoemulsions. Compared with the traditional titration method (drop method), the PDMPD method enables a more exact status description of mixtures in pseudo ternary diagrams. It offers as well the possibility of examining the dilution stages simultaneously on just one microplate (Schmidts et al., 2009). Fig. 2 Phase diagram To develop this method, several pre-tests were made in different conditions. In the first experimental setup the vortex was used to shake 2 overlying plates, as shown on Fig.3, at speeds 3, 2 and 1 and then one single plate at speeds 3, 2 and 1, for 16h. These pre-tests showed unrepeatable results and spilling. Therefore, the method was changed: the vortex was substituted by the rocking platform. Different time periods were also pre-tested. Testing plates were set on the rocking platform for 8h, 9h, 16h, 18h, 20h and 22h. The chosen mixing time was 16h as it was the minimum length time tested for which reproducible results were observed, i.e., 18h, 20h and 22h showed the same results as 16h mixing on the Rocket Platform.
